Output 377d93aeab8d80fc1c93484ed21f64c349ea6375100d78bec0959231a02de809:1

value
21148177
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3611f311df1c2f792ae3784222c264728dfbc6bd OP_EQUALVERIFY OP_CHECKSIG
address
15vtzWfFuvrNcw23PwCxkb2B3bz3C9Rram
transaction
377d93aeab8d80fc1c93484ed21f64c349ea6375100d78bec0959231a02de809
confirmations
307664
spent
true